Zero. But I feel like putting on my box office nerd hat, even though I'm sure I'll regret it:

Mega Mana posted...
"The film was released on August 29, 2012. On its opening weekend, the film became the biggest box office bomb of all time for films released in at least 2,000 theaters."
It was the worst domestic debut ever for a movie released in at least 2,000 theaters. As a whole, though, Oogieloves was too cheap to wind up among the biggest bombs on record - all movies that lost over $100 million adjusted, according to Wikipedia's sources.

linkhatesganon posted...
How is Sinbad in the top 10 if it actually made more money worldwide than its net budget
Sinbad's top 10 position does confuse me, but that's not the reason why. It's not hard to see that it was a box office bomb when you consider that theaters take a cut of their own from any given movie's box office, and that said cut typically rests around 50%. It's more that those numbers shouldn't add up to a $125 million loss on paper, unless its budget was drastically underestimated. If DreamWorks indeed "suffered a $125 million loss on a string of films" (to quote Wikipedia's article) around that time, of which Sinbad was one, that would explain it, but the source that provides that figure suggests that Sinbad alone produced that much red ink.
